Abstract

See full text

Threshold logic gates are disclosed that respond to signals that may assume at least a first state having an arithmetic or logic meaning, and a second NULL state that has no arithmetic or logic meaning. Threshold values may be equal to or less than the number of input signal lines. Threshold gates switch their outputs from NULL to a meaningful state when the threshold number of inputs assume meaningful states. Gates will hold outputs in a meaningful (or non-null) state when the number of asserted inputs remains positive, even if the number is less than the threshold. In one embodiment, threshold gates include a 'FLASH' input that forces the gate to NULL. In another embodiment, threshold gates include one or more 'SET' inputs that drive the gate output to NULL or to a meaningfull state.
